At its core, the high-ticket fitness approach involves offering premium packages designed to address specific needs and goals of clients. These packages, often tailored to individual preferences and health objectives, come at a premium price point, presenting an enticing prospect for gym owners seeking to boost their bottom line.

The fitness landscape is evolving, and gym owners are realizing that a one-size-fits-all model is no longer sufficient to meet the diverse needs of their clientele. High-ticket fitness packages are designed to provide a more personalized and comprehensive experience, offering specialized training, nutrition guidance, and exclusive amenities. This not only enhances the overall value proposition for clients but also positions the gym as a premium destination in a saturated market.

The financial implications of this shift are profound. Gyms embracing the high-ticket approach are witnessing a surge in revenue that extends well beyond traditional membership fees. Clients are willing to invest in their health and well-being, and this willingness translates into increased profitability for forward-thinking gym owners.
